In this workshop you’ll learn how to use glass etching paste to create something beautiful from recycled glass containers.   Etching paste, as the name suggests, etches into the surface of glass creating opaque areas.  Unlike some spray on treatments, this effect is permanent and does not wear off.

Aimed at those completely new to working with glass etching paste (or any form of crafting) this fun workshop will teach you how to safely use glass etching paste.   Working with stencils, or free-hand, you’ll learn how to apply the paste and create designs on glass.

You’ll start by creating a simple glass coaster or tree ornament (it’s never too early to start prepping for Christmas!).  Then you’ll learn how to cut a wine bottle in half and prepare the base to be used as a candle jar.  Once you have decorated it, Carol will fill it with fragranced soy wax and you will have a unique candle to take away with you.

This workshop is suitable for those with no crafting experience, or those who are experienced crafters but have never tried working with glass etching paste.  No prior experience is necessary; you will be guided and supported throughout the process.  Due to the nature of the chemicals used, this workshop is not suitable for children under 16 years of age.
